Women mobilised to drive HIV prevention

Shamaine Chirimujiri THE government has called for an in­tensified HIV prevention drive targeting women and girls to combat dispropor­tionate infection rates nationwide. The call comes as Zimbabwe con­tinues to record a decline in new HIV infections, although women remain disproportionately affected, with an HIV prevalence rate of 14.7 percent compared to 8.7 percent among men….
